Revisions: Bulk Paint Update & Selective Item Deletion

Fabritec now allows greater flexibility when creating a new revision inside Phases Explorer.
When adding a new revision (Revision 1 and above), you can:
Change the paint system for selected items
Delete specific items directly from the table
This eliminates the need to upload a completely new sheet for minor adjustments and gives you precise control over revision changes.

πŸ“ Where This Applies#

Navigate to:
Projects β†’ Select Project β†’ Phases Explorer β†’ Add Revision
These features are available inside:
Step 1: Add Items

Change Paint for Selected Items#

You can now update the paint system for one or multiple items directly inside the revision.

How to Change Paint#

1.
Select one or more items from the table
2.
Click Change Paint
3.
Choose the new paint type
4.
Click Save

The selected items will immediately reflect the new paint system.

When to Use This#

Client requests coating changes
Engineering updates paint specifications
Correcting imported paint data
Aligning items with updated finishing requirements

Important Notes#

Paint changes will appear in View Changes
Approval Validation will check if paint changes conflict with production progress
The updated paint will reflect in the BOM Report

Delete Selected Items from a Revision#

Instead of uploading a new revision sheet to remove items, you can now delete specific items directly from the revision table.

How to Delete Items#

1.
Select the items you want to remove
2.
Click Delete
3.
Confirm the deletion
The selected items will be removed from the current revision only.

⚠️ What Happens After Deletion?#

Deleted items will appear as Removed in View Changes
Approval Validation will verify:
If the item has started production
If the item is already completed
If deletion conflicts with live production data
If production has already started, the system may block approval until resolved.

How This Affects Revision Comparison#

Both actions (paint change and deletion):
Are tracked in revision history
Appear clearly in View Changes
Are included in approval validation checks
Maintain full traceability between revisions
This ensures transparency and controlled decision-making.

Why This Update Matters#

Previously, small modifications required:
Uploading a new Excel sheet
Reprocessing the full item list
Now you can:
Make targeted updates
Reduce rework
Maintain revision precision
Save engineering time
This enhancement improves flexibility while maintaining Fabritec’s strict revision control and production validation logic.

⭐ Best Practice#

Use bulk paint changes for specification updates to change the type of paint from within the revision for some items in case there are multiple types of paint in the phase.
Use selective deletion only when items are intentionally removed.
Always review View Changes before approval.
Run Approval Validation before accepting the revision.
